Output 4d24610ecd74a3c49c1625686f98fc95eab32c6b94743b042c359e02efe14227:3

value
28180038
script pubkey
OP_0 OP_PUSHBYTES_20 d5a5d3bd30ccc9e17e6ca0023d7eaad5bc5eba7c
address
bc1q6kja80fseny7zlnv5qpr6l426k79awnuq8r335
transaction
4d24610ecd74a3c49c1625686f98fc95eab32c6b94743b042c359e02efe14227
spent
true